    Mental Health Challenges in Law Enforcement

    Law enforcement officers often face immense pressure, both physically and mentally. The ex-detective's suicide note before trial sheds light on the mental health challenges faced by those in the profession. Studies have shown that:

    • Approximately 25% of police officers experience symptoms of PTSD.
    • Depression and anxiety are common among law enforcement personnel.
    • Access to mental health resources remains limited in many departments.

    According to a report by the National Institute of Mental Health, addressing these issues requires systemic changes and increased support for officers.
